What is SR22 insurance quotes ?

SR22 insurance, frequently referred to as a certificate of financial responsibility, is not a kind of insurance in itself however rather, a record that proves a driver brings the minimum liability insurance required by the state. It is basically an official type sent by the insured's insurer to the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). The type works as an assurance to the DMV that the insurance companies have covered the person in inquiry to the minimum necessary level. Hence, it is not identifiable as regular insurance but a qualification attesting a person adhering to his/her insurance obligations.

Often, drivers that have their licenses put on hold or withdrawed as a result of serious infractions such as a DUI or DWI, reckless driving, or being at-fault in an accident, are needed to lug SR-22 insurance. It is normally compulsory for a size of time, normally 3 years, and during this period, the car driver must preserve continual protection. If the driver falls short to satisfy this need, the SR-22 form is terminated by the insurance firm, which subsequently notifies the DMV, possibly causing an additional suspension of the vehicle driver's certificate. This shows the vital duty of SR22 insurance in applying financial responsibility amongst high-risk drivers.

Exactly What is Financial Responsibility?

Financial responsibility defines the requirement that all drivers must be capable of spending for any type of damage or injury they may create while running a motor automobile. This responsibility is generally satisfied with liability coverage, one of the main kinds of insurance policies that car drivers can choose. It could likewise be satisfied through other insurance kinds such as non-owner car insurance, particularly ideal for individuals that typically rent or obtain automobiles yet don't possess a car themselves. Additionally, this concept also prolongs to parents or guardians that have a child, under their treatment, driving a vehicle. In such cases, the adult is liable for making sure the young driver fulfills the financial responsibility requirements.

On the other hand, there are situations where more rigorous financial responsibility demands play a considerable role, specifically, when it pertains to SR-22 motorists. An SR-22 form serves as a proof of insurance for high-risk drivers and is filed with the state by the driver's insurance provider. Minimum coverage is a demand for SR-22 car drivers and the insurance premiums associated are typically higher. Confirming financial responsibility via keeping the needed minimum coverage is necessary for SR-22 drivers for a certain time period, generally 3 years. This makes sure that the motorist maintains continuous insurance coverage, urging safer driving actions.

Non-Owner Car Insurance and an SR22 Filing with the DMV

When an individual is caught drunk of drugs while running a vehicle, one of the measures taken by the court could consist of a requirement for SR22 insurance in enhancement to the person's current policy. The DMV requireds this sort of insurance coverage to ensure the person's capacity to meet liability requirements in situation of a future accident. Even if the person does not possess an automobile, this need might still need to be fulfilled. Under these situations, a non-owner policy can be an option, which is an unique sort of SR22 insurance that offers the needed insurance coverage.

Non-owner car insurance meets the court-ordered demand and can be lower in price than other types of SR22 insurance, provided the person doesn't have an automobile to guarantee. What is SR22 Insurance?

SR22 Insurance is a record that supplies proof of financial responsibility. It confirms that the person filing has the minimum liability insurance required by state legislation.

Who really requires SR22 Insurance?

SR22 Insurance is frequently required for car drivers who have been involved in at-fault crashes, convicted of driving under the influence, or have actually collected a lot of offense factors on their driving record.

What are the benefits of SR22 Insurance?

The main benefit of SR22 Insurance is that it allows individuals to keep or reinstate their driving privileges after a severe traffic violation or accident.

Exactly How does SR22 Insurance add to financial responsibility?

SR22 Insurance demonstrates a motorist's capacity to cover any kind of future crashes' economic liabilities. It's an assurance that the driver has and will certainly keep insurance coverage.

What are the DMV's regulations pertaining to SR22 Insurance?

The regulations relating to SR22 Insurance vary by state, yet generally, the driver should keep the insurance for a given period, generally three years. Failure to do so can result in license suspension.

What are the common reasons for requiring an SR22 type submission to the DMV?

Common reasons consist of DUI sentences, serious or repeated traffic offenses, and being at fault in an accident without insurance.

What kinds of coverage does SR22 Insurance provide?

The coverage varies, but it generally consists of liability insurance for bodily injury and building damages.

What are the minimum coverage requirements for an SR22 filing with the DMV?

The minimum coverage requirements vary by state, however typically, it should a minimum of satisfy the state's minimum liability insurance requirements.

What is non-owner car insurance in terms of an SR22 filing?

Non-owner car insurance is for individuals that don't have a vehicle however still need to submit an SR22 form. This covers them when they drive another person's cars and truck.

What traffic violations or accidents might need an SR22 declaring?

Significant offenses like Drunk drivings, reckless driving, or being at mistake in an accident while uninsured generally necessitate an SR22 filing.

What takes place if I'm at mistake in an accident that causes license suspension, will I require an SR22?

Yes, usually in such instances an SR22 declaring will be called for to reinstate your driving privileges.
